JULY 4, 2013 SCHEDULE OF EVENTS
| 8 a.m. | Boogie's Buddy Race, Boogie's Diner $40 for adults, $50 race-day registration, $15 for kids under 16, $80 family rate for 1-mile walk Celebrate the Fourth of July by running or walking to support the Buddy Program! Choose between a challenging but festive 5-mile race with cash prizes or a family and canine 1-mile walk. Sign up online at www.buddyprogram.org or in person in front of Boogie's Diner June 30 - July 3. The Buddy Program, 970-920-2130 |
| 10 a.m. | Kid's Bicycle Decorating, Paepcke Park Open to kids riding bicycles in the parade HELMETS MANDATORY FOR KIDS AND ADULTS - No scooters or electric vehicles please |
| 10 a.m. - 2 p.m. | 13th Annual "America's Birthday Carnival," Paepcke Park Early Learning Center's kids' carnival featuring games, food, silent auction, and bake sale Early Learning Center, 970-920-9201 |
| 12 Noon | Old Fashioned 4th of July PARADE, Main Street FREE to participate, mandatory registration Parade Information and Entry Forms - City of Aspen, www.aspen4th.com, 970-429-2093 |
| 1 - 4 p.m. | AVSC 4th of July Picnic, Koch Park $10 for adults, $5 for children under 10 Come catch up with old friends, play some volleyball, and have an icy cold beer all while supporting the largest youth non-profit in the Valley, Aspen Valley Ski & Snowboard Club Aspen Valley Ski and Snowboard Club, www.teamavsc.org, 970-205-5100 |
| 1:30 p.m. | Aspen Art Museum's FREE 4th of July Community Picnic, Aspen Art Museum The AAM partners with a renowned contemporary artist to produce a float for Aspen's Fourth of July Parade. The AAM's popular annual post-parade picnic takes place on the museum grounds. Aspen Art Museum, www.aspenartmuseum.org, 970-925-8050 |
| 4 p.m. | The Aspen Music Festival and School's FREE Fourth of July Concert, Benedict Music Tent A beloved tradition, this celebration brings the AMFS band to the Tent stage with stirring patriotic favorites. Lawrence Isaacson, conductor; Anna Deavere Smith, narrator; Barbara Fleck, guest conductor Sponsored by the City of Aspen with special thanks to Melani and Rob Walton Aspen Music Festival and School, www.aspenmusicfestival.com, 970-925-9042 |
| 6:30 p.m. | Les Miserables, The Hurst Theatre in Rio Grande Park Special 30th Anniversary Ticket Price: $30 for adults, $15 for kids 12 and under Epic, grand, and uplifting, Les Miserables packs an emotional wallop with its sung-through pop operas and its powerful affirmation of the human spirit that have made it a popular masterpiece. Theatre Aspen, www.theatreaspen.org, 970-925-9313 |
| 8 - 10:30 p.m. | "Dancing In The Streets" Band TBD, Mill St./Cooper Ave. Mall FREE community street dance and concert (20 minute intermission during Firework Display) Aspen Chamber Resort Association, www.aspenchamber.org, 970-925-1940 |
| 9:15 p.m. | Fireworks Extravaganza over Aspen Mountain, TBD - Weather Permitting |
| SCHEDULE OF EVENTS SUBJECT TO CHANGE |
Transportation tips:
- Parking in Aspen will be extremely limited. Ride RFTA, walk or bike for a stress-free day! Bus info is available at 970-925-8484 or at http://www.rfta.com/.
- FREE parking will be available at the Brush Creek Park & Ride with free and frequent bus service to and from Aspen.
- The Cross Town Shuttle will operate until approximately 11pm from June 27-July 4 to accommodate various festivities. The last departure from the Music Tent will be at 10:45pm.
- Your bus may be rerouted during the 4th of July parade, call or check the web for more details.
- Be sure to comply with all posted parking regulations and watch for special parking and street closures to avoid a ticket or tow.
